The process for mesothelioma lawsuits varies from state to state. The majority of lawsuits are settled before they are brought to trial. Settlements are reached between the parties after they have agreed on an the amount to be compensated to the victim. Compensation typically includes both economic and noneconomic damages. Economic damages can include treatment costs, lost income and other documented expenses. Noneconomic damages may include physical pain and mental suffering.

Mesothelioma compensation is available to victims through three sources - asbestos trust funds and lawsuits, as well as settlements. Asbestos trust funds are set up by bankrupt asbestos companies to ensure their victims and their families receive compensation for asbestos-related illnesses. Victims can be compensated for mesothelioma in just 90 days if their claim is successful. The amount of compensation awarded will depend on a range of factors, including the method of review and which mesothelioma trust fund to file with. Accelerated reviews provide a speedy settlement for claims that meet the pre-set guidelines and individual reviews provide a more in-depth look at the case.

The duration of a mesothelioma claim will vary based on the compensation sought. In a majority of instances, the defendants in a mesothelioma lawsuit will settle to avoid expensive litigation and the possibility of losing the case altogether. If the defendants don't wish to settle their case it could take more than a year before a decision is reached.

In the event of a trial verdict, the jury will determine who is responsible and compensate the victim or their family. Compensation is usually paid out in monthly installments rather than the lump sum.

Compensation amounts for asbestos-related victims can differ based on how their claim is evaluated by a mesothelioma settlement foundation. If the claim meets certain criteria and is approved, the claim will be paid an amount that is fixed under expedited reviews. Individual reviews however will conduct a more in-depth look at the claim prior to determining what it is worth.
